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from The Westin Pasadena to Rose Bowl Game is to line 33 bus which costs $1 and takes 29 min.
The fastest way to get from The Westin Pasadena to Rose Bowl Game is to taxi which takes 5 min and costs $11 - $14.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Marengo Ave & Corson St and arriving at Lincoln Ave & Mountain St.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 7 min.
The distance between The Westin Pasadena and Rose Bowl Game is 4 miles.
The best way to get from The Westin Pasadena to Rose Bowl Game without a car is to line 33 bus which takes 29 min and costs $1.
The line 33 bus from Marengo Ave & Corson St to Lincoln Ave & Mountain St takes 7 min including transfers and departs hourly.
The Westin Pasadena to Rose Bowl Game bus services, operated by Pasadena Transit, depart from Marengo Ave & Corson St station.
The Westin Pasadena to Rose Bowl Game bus services, operated by Pasadena Transit, arrive at Lincoln Ave & Mountain St station.
